Young director takes charge

James Ewens, 10, who emerged through CYT’s workshop program, seized the chance to director “The Last Dragon’s Tooth”, one of the short plays making up CYT’s upcoming production Artists Unite.

His play is an adventure story that sees the reluctant young hero Tom, set out on a dangerous quest to bring back the only cure for his dying father, the last dragon’s tooth on earth.

Journeying through the Cliffs of Doom to the Cave of Mystery, he is met by weird creatures and finds personal courage.

Ewens went into the rehearsal period with a strong vision for the play and has demonstrated a talent beyond his years for guiding the adventure both on stage and off.

With a cast of eight young people (the oldest is 12) director Ewens was working under the guidance of artistic director Karla Conway.

“The Last Dragon’s Tooth” is one of four short plays by emerging playwrights, directed by emerging directors and designed by emerging set, costume, lighting and sound designers. Each play has its own creative team, mentored by professionals in their field.

The Last Dragon’s Tooth joins “Silver Gelatin” by Camilla Sheather-Neumann, “Frog’s Body” by Olivia Hewson and “Circcestra” by Farnoush Parsiavashi.

Canberra Youth Theatre presents “Artists Unite”, C-Block Theatre – Gorman House Arts Centre, previews, 7pm November 22, 23, performances: 7pm November 24, 25, 26 with a matinee, 2pm November 26. Bookings to www.cytc.net
